@Marcin_Hakemer-Ferna Actually, this info may surprise you Mudita Pure is responsibly designed, developed and manufactured in Europe. More than half ( 59% )of the components will come from companies headquartered in the US; some of the components, such as the battery, are made in China, because some components are only produced there.
